Transaction ed15ddf685ccb75683fff42048587bccf73f47fed45e5c30ebee2573d8ea3038
1 Input
1 Output
-
ed15ddf685ccb75683fff42048587bccf73f47fed45e5c30ebee2573d8ea3038:0
- value
- 356782
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b403bb392c61e8fc0c85b6b138e048e9443d036f OP_EQUAL
- address
- 3J6r2LAwSbDSJgHn2H5XLBhwWWBTmXeg1w